Choosing the Right Portable Gas Cooking Stove

1. Fuel Type:

Portable gas cooking stoves use either propane or butane gas. Propane is more widely available and less expensive, while butane burns cleaner and is better suited for colder climates.

2. BTU Output:

BTU (British Thermal Units) measures heat output. Higher BTU stoves heat up faster and cook food more efficiently. Consider the types of meals you will be preparing and choose a stove with an appropriate BTU output.

3. Features:

Some portable gas cooking stoves come with additional features such as built-in igniters, simmer control, and even grilling grates. Choose a stove that has the features you need and fits your budget.

4. Size and Weight:

Consider the size and weight of the stove relative to the number of people you will be cooking for and the activities you will be engaging in.

Safety Precautions

1. Use Only Outdoors:

Never use a portable gas cooking stove indoors as the combustion process produces carbon monoxide.

2. Ventilate Properly:

Ensure adequate ventilation when using the stove, especially in enclosed areas like tents or shelters.

3. Check Connections:

Before each use, inspect the fuel line and connections for leaks or damage.

4. Keep Away from Flammables:

Place the stove away from flammable materials such as tents, clothing, and dry vegetation.

Tips and Tricks

1. Use a Windscreen:

A windscreen helps shield the flame from the wind, making it more stable and reducing cooking time.

2. Protect the Stove:

Use a carrying case or storage bag to protect the stove from damage when not in use.

3. Clean Regularly:

Keep your portable gas cooking stove clean by wiping it down after each use. This will extend its lifespan and prevent build-up.

4. Pack Extra Fuel:

Always carry an extra canister or two of gas, especially on extended trips, to avoid running out of fuel at the wrong time.

5. Store Safely:

Store the stove in a well-ventilated area away from heat sources and potential ignition sources.

How to Use a Portable Gas Cooking Stove Step-by-Step

1. Assemble the Stove:

Connect the burner head to the fuel canister and attach the legs to the base.

2. Open the Gas Valve:

Slowly open the gas valve by turning the knob counterclockwise.

3. Light the Flame:

Press and hold the ignition button to spark and ignite the flame.

4. Adjust the Flame:

Turn the gas valve knob to adjust the flame size as needed.

5. Place the Pan on the Burner:

Center the cookware on the burner grate and begin cooking.

6. Turn Off the Stove:

After cooking, turn the gas valve knob clockwise to shut off the gas flow.
